Job Description:

Join Our Client's Growing Team as a Fully Qualified Accountant! Diepeveen and Partners, a boutique search firm, is seeking talented candidates for an exciting opportunity with one of our prestigious clients. Our client has evolved from an international consulting firm into a leading business investment and services group, focusing on venture capital, flexible infrastructure, and corporate business services. Due to their continued expansion, they are now looking for an experienced Fully Qualified Accountant.

Job Responsibility:

  • Manage accounting for costs/receipts, bank, cash, suppliers, and customers
  • Perform monthly reconciliations of customer and supplier analyses
  • Conduct monthly inventory of fixed assets and manage invoicing
  • Maintain stock records and monitor investments in progress
  • Handle monthly, quarterly, and annual closings, including report preparation and account balance reconciliation
  • Collaborate with the payroll department and provide necessary data
  • Prepare and submit timely tax returns and manage VAT analytics
  • Reconcile tax current accounts and year-end general ledger, and execute closing tasks
  • Prepare year-end returns and publish final balance sheets and accounts
  • Facilitate the audit process by providing information and maintaining auditor contacts
  • Update accounting policies and initiate transfers

Requirements:

  • Degree in finance/accounting
  • Extensive knowledge of Hungarian accounting and tax legislation
  • Minimum of three years' experience in comprehensive company accounting
  • Proficiency in IFRS or US GAAP
  • Chartered, registered accountant status or qualifications to register
  • Professional communication skills in English (because of international clients)
  • Strong knowledge of MS Office applications
